Fattal raises €315m to buy 30 European hotels

Israeli resort chain operator Fattal Holdings (1998) Ltd. (TASE: FTAL) has described that it has raised €315 million from Israeli institutional traders led by Harel Insurance policies Investments and Financial Companies (TASE: HARL) and Menorah Mivtachim Team (TASE: MMHD) in buy to expand its lodge portfolio in Europe. The total elevated could raise to €400 million if Leumi Partners and other traders be part of the offer.

Fattal intends acquiring 30 resorts and the organization, controlled by David Fattal (65%) options focusing its acquisitions on Western Europe, mostly in Germany, Spain and the British isles but the business mentioned it would also take into account acquisitions in Poland, Greece and Portugal. The organization claimed that it has previously purchased two motels with 260 rooms in Malaga and Majorca in Spain for €40 million.

Fattal now sees an prospect in the wake of the Covid pandemic and thinks that whilst some constraints are continue to in spot in some EU nations around the world, occupancy concentrations and bookings indicate that the disaster is for the most portion more than, and the Russia-Ukraine war has not impacted tourism in Western Europe.

Fattal CFO Shahar Aka claimed, “The Covid disaster has designed an possibility in Europe to purchase resort assets at interesting costs. The firm’s administration has been uncovered to a lot of chances on the continent in modern months and we believe that that additional possibilities will be created in the course of 2022 as lodge proprietors who will be demanded to refinance financial loans that they have taken in the previous from banking institutions may well experience financing troubles.”

As of March 2022, Fattal was working 192 hotels which ended up open up out of 227 in the chain. The corporation operates 170 inns in Europe and 57 in Israel. Fattal operates in 19 countries and has 64 motels in Germany and 48 lodges in the British isles.

In March 2022, Fattal recorded normal occupancy of 60% in its Israeli motels in comparison with 74% in advance of the outbreak of the Covid pandemic in 2019. Typical occupancy in Europe was 52.8% when compared with 79% prior to the pandemic in 2019.
